Last Sunday our German friends from the sister city of Karlsruhe (this town is located in Germany, in the land of Baden-württemberg, and it is located in the vicinity of the Rhine river near the French-German border) came to us and showed their culinary skills in the manufacture of the famous pretzels, which were treated to everyone.

Most of the pretzels are shaped in the form of a knot. The unique shape of such pretzels is a symmetrical loop, which is created by weaving a not very long strip of dough into a bizarre pattern, forming a kind of pretzel loop.

These pretzels even sculpted Kuban mayor Eugene Pervushov, who also decided to participate in the process.

I'll tell you, it's delicious.

In Germany, such bread and bakery products are called brezels. There is an old legend which says that brezel was invented by a Baker, who was commissioned by the Bavarian king to bake a loaf through which 3 times you can see the sun.

Brezel, in Germany, is the emblem of bakers and is very often depicted on the private signs of bakeries or bakeries engaged in the manufacture of bread and various muffins.

But in the middle ages, the production of brezels was not allowed to all bakers, but only a limited circle of people.
